Michigan Wolverines Search for New Head Coach After Dusty May’s Departure

A look at the leading candidates and what they bring to the program

The University of Michigan basketball program is embarking on a search for a new head coach after Dusty May accepted the same role with the Dallas Mavericks. May’s departure comes without a buyout obligation, leaving the athletic department to chart a fresh direction for the storied program.

Mike Boynton, currently serving as the interim head coach, brings a power‑conference pedigree from his tenure at Oklahoma State. His familiarity with the Big Ten landscape and proven ability to manage high‑pressure situations have positioned him as a natural internal candidate.

Billy Donovan, a former NBA assistant and college head coach who most recently guided the University of Florida to a national championship, is also on the radar. Donovan’s blend of professional and collegiate experience offers a unique perspective that could appeal to the Wolverines’ leadership.

Who’s Who in the Hunt

Josh Schertz, the mastermind behind Saint Louis’s recent 29‑6 campaign, has drawn attention for his ability to build disciplined, defensive‑oriented teams. His success at a mid‑major program suggests he could translate that rigor to the Big Ten.

Ben McCollum, head coach at Iowa, led the Hawkeyes to the Elite Eight and is celebrated for an offensive philosophy that maximizes talent within a competitive conference. His fresh approach could inject new energy into Michigan’s playbook.

John Beilein, a Michigan legend who steered the Wolverines to the 2018 national title game, is being mentioned despite his age of 73. His deep connection to the university and championship pedigree could provide a short‑term boost, though the administration may weigh a longer‑term vision.

The decision will likely hinge on how each candidate aligns with the program’s immediate goals and long‑term aspirations. Michigan’s leadership has indicated a preference for a coach who can quickly stabilize the roster while also laying the groundwork for sustained success.
